CI note: Burrowatch scanner flaking on registry mirror timeouts

Heads up for the sync — the Burrowatch typo-squat scanner has been red about one run in five, and it's not catching anything real. The registry mirror times out during the metadata fetch, the scanner treats that as a suspicious package, and CI blocks the merge. Short-term fix: retries with backoff are in the latest scanner build, and false positives dropped to zero in staging overnight. Grab that build if you're debugging locally; its trace token is right below.

build token for kagaf-hahof: htk14_9d3d4d26d7d8de

## Quotaflow Environments

Quotaflow enforces per-tenant rate quotas at the gateway in all three environments. Staging mirrors prod multipliers; dev runs with quotas relaxed 10x. Quotas are evaluated per tenant ID per rolling 60s window; bursts above the soft cap get queued, hard cap returns 429. Overrides for premium tenants live in the tenant registry, not here. When reviewing, check the multiplier math against the window size. Current production values are as follows.

config for tajof-yaguf:
[istox]
team = aldius
access_code = ac_29be1b
owner = holok.praix
host = istox.zarqelsoft.test
port = 11211
peer = novath.olvarqio.example
salt = 983a9dc6
pin = 4652

# Security review notes: trip thresholds bound blast radius if Veldspar
# is compromised or degraded; half-open probes are rate-limited so a
# hostile upstream cannot force rapid reconnect storms. All timeouts
# are enforced client-side in the Bramblegate gateway — never trust
# upstream keepalive hints. Changing these values changes our exposure
# window during an upstream incident, so any edit requires sign-off
# from the Harrowick security rotation. The enforced constants follow.

limits module of fajog-tawig:
RATE_LIMITS = {
    "druwyn": 2,
    "quenael": 10,
    "wenix": 2,
    "druael": 2,
}

Quarterly Planning Note — Merrivale Goods

We intend to transition Tier 1 customer support to an outsourced partner in Kestrun by the end of Q3. Training of the external team begins mid-quarter, with a four-week parallel-run period. Sales leads should reassure key accounts that named escalation contacts remain unchanged. The rationale and timing considerations are set out below.

confidential, hahop-bajep: Gross margin on Ralath came in at 5 percent against a plan of 10 percent. Only 9 of the 100 pilot accounts renewed Ralath, so a churn review is set for April 1.